Geodude (#56) is a Common card from EX - Dragon released in 2003. It showcases artwork by Midori Harada and the Steady Punch attack (10+ damage), Flip a coin. If heads, this attack does 10 damage plus 10 more damage.. TCGplayer market price sits around $0.63, Cardmarket average sale is €0.21, Floor listings start near €0.02.
